Understanding Your Marketing Needs

Before diving into budgeting, it’s crucial to assess your specific marketing needs. This involves identifying your target audience, understanding their preferences, and determining the most effective channels to reach them. For instance, a local coffee shop in Austin, Texas, found that focusing on social media and community events significantly boosted their visibility. By conducting thorough market research analysis, they were able to pinpoint their ideal customer demographics and tailor their marketing efforts accordingly.

Once you have a clear understanding of your marketing needs, you can allocate your budget more effectively. This means prioritizing channels that yield the highest engagement and conversion rates. For example, the same coffee shop invested in pay-per-click advertising, resulting in a 30% increase in foot traffic within just three months. This demonstrates the importance of aligning your budget with your marketing goals to achieve measurable outcomes.

Measuring Success and Adjusting Strategies

To maximize ROI, it’s essential to measure the success of your marketing efforts continuously. This involves t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) such as conversion rates, customer acquisition costs, and overall revenue growth. By analyzing these metrics, businesses can identify which strategies are working and which need adjustment. For example, the coffee shop in Austin regularly reviewed their marketing analytics, allowing them to pivot their strategies based on real-time data.

Adjusting your marketing strategies based on performance data not only optimizes your budget but also enhances your overall marketing effectiveness. If a particular channel is underperforming, reallocating funds to more successful initiatives can lead to better results. This agile approach to marketing budgeting ensures that new businesses can adapt to changing market conditions and consumer preferences, ultimately leading to sustained growth.
